We are an interconnected community of engineering consultants and specialists that bring to bear cutting-edge integrated thinking, best practice, and strident creativity to make a project vision viable, whether that vision is for a building, a neighbourhood or an entire city.
We strive to offer our employees a real purpose at work; to be part of a global community that is shaping the future of our built environment. Our employees are challenged to solve the major problems facing societies today and together we are proud to deliver elegant and sustainable solutions for our buildings and cities.
We've worked on some iconic projects including, the Millennium Dome, the High Line Park, New York, the 2012 Olympic Park and its subsequent urban regeneration into the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park.
